Blurb

When a wounded alpha werewolf collapses in the moon garden of a reclusive hedge witch, neither of them expects their lives to change forever.

Elara Thorn has spent years protecting her enchanted cottage, avoiding pack politics, and ignoring the dark magic stalking the forests around Briarwood Hollow. Lucien, the feared alpha of the Moonridge Pack, arrives bleeding from silver wounds after a betrayal that should have killed him. He doesn't trust witches. She doesn't trust wolves or men. Unfortunately, fate has other plans.

As an ancient mating bond awakens between them, the two are forced into an uneasy alliance while mysterious creatures gather beyond the wards protecting Elara's home. Strange voices call from the woods. A haunted manor appears where no building should exist. The dead whisper familiar lullabies, and a forgotten evil begins weaving its way back into the world.

Adding to the chaos are Elara's delightfully opinionated companions: Mortimer, a sarcastic talking raven with endless commentary, and Pip, an adventurous fruit bat whose curiosity often leads everyone into trouble. Their humor balances the danger, creating a story filled with laugh-out-loud moments alongside heart-pounding suspense.
